I’ve never seen a Greek store this big!! L & O Greek Specialities is the Walmart for all of us Greeks!!!! #Divine9
SUBSCRIBE
MORE VIDEOS
WEBSITE
FOLLOW Facebook: Instagram: Twitter:
#RickeySmiley source
luck
January 26, 2025
January 25, 2025